Kerem …On average, the Montgomery Ward sewing machine value sits between $50 and $1,000. These machines sit in two categories—antique and vintage. The antique models have been around for more than 100 years—all machines produced before the 1920s. The vintage models were manufactured between 1920 and 1999.

Some vintage Necchi sewing machines can be bought for as little as $50, while others can cost upwards of $500 or even more. However, most vintage Necchi sewing machines are valued anywhere between $100 and $300. A Davis treadle machine from 1886 in very good condition sold for $215. It included the original sewing surface and was in lovely shape. A Davis Under Feed machine with worn decals and no cabinet or treadle base sold for $50. A Davis vertical feed sewing machine from 1877 sold for only about $15. It was rusty and in poor condition.

The Singer ‘class 12’ (12K in England) or ‘New Family' domestic machine of 1865 (Figure 1) was the foundation of Singer’s dominance of the sewing machine market. It was the most successful machine of the nineteenth century and, although Singer gave up manufacturing it in the 1890s, clones of it continued to be made up until the 1930s.
